Heroes & Villains logo
Heroes & Villains logo

All articles

Tracking hasn't movedUpdated 2 years ago

We ask that you keep an eye on your tracking! 

If your tracking link says "Pending" or your delivery date hasn't been updated in over 10 business days (excluding weekends), please reach out to us so we can take a look ASAP!  [email protected] 

Was this article helpful?